TANCET MBA Question Paper Pattern
| Features |
Details |
|---|---|
| Sections |
- Business Situations (20 questions) - Reading Comprehension (20 questions) - Quantitative Ability (20 questions) - Data Sufficiency (20 questions) - English Usage (20 questions) |
| Total number of questions |
100 |
| Total time duration |
120 minutes |
| Sectional time limit |
No |
| Marking scheme |
(+)1 for correct responses; (-)1/3 for incorrect responses |
| Total marks |
100 |
| Type of questions |
MCQs |

TANCET MCA Question Paper Pattern
| Features |
Details |
|---|---|
| Sections |
- Quantitative Aptitude (25 questions) - Analytical Reasoning (25 questions) - Logical Reasoning (25 questions) - Computer Awareness (25 questions) |
| Total number of questions |
100 |
| Total time duration |
120 minutes |
| Sectional time limit |
No |
| Marking scheme |
(+)1 for correct responses; (-)1/3 for incorrect responses |
| Total marks |
100 |
| Type of questions |
MCQs |

TANCET Question Paper Pattern for MTech/MArch/MPlan
| Features |
Details |
|---|---|
| Sections |
- Part I (Engineering Mathematics) - Part II (Basic Engg. & Sciences) - Part III (For different disciplines) |
| Total number of questions |
115 |
| Total time duration |
120 minutes |
| Sectional time limit |
No |
| Negative marking |
(-)1/3 for incorrect responses |
| Total marks |
100 |
| Type of questions |
MCQs |
The first two parts of the TANCET ME/MTech/MArch/MPlan are common irrespective of the discipline chosen by the candidate. The third part of the TANCET question paper varies based on the discipline/subject chosen by the candidate. The table below mentions the sectional distribution that was followed in TANCET MTech question paper 2022:
Explore colleges based on TANCET
| Parts |
Number of Questions |
Total Marks |
|---|---|---|
| Part I (Engineering Mathematics) |
20 |
20 |
| Part II (Basic Engg. & Sciences) |
35 |
20 |
| Part III (For different disciplines) |
60 |
60 |
| Total |
115 |
100 |

TANCET exam does not have any descriptive type questions. All the questions in the TANCET question paper are objective type questions, also known as Multiple Choice Questions. Anna University design the TANCET test paper to ask questions with four answers options. Out of these four options, one answers is correct, while other three answers are incorrect. Candidates have to choose the right answers to fetch 1 mark. For every incorrect response, candidates will get a education of 1/3 marks. All 100 questions in the TANCET exam are objective type.
TANCET exam coprises as many as 100 objective type questions. TANCET MBA exam has five sections with equal question weightage. Therefore, each section will have 20 questions each. Candidates have to answer all the questions. However, in case of incorrect responses, candidates will face a penalty of 1/3 mark. Each correct answer will fetch 1 mark.

| Section | Number of Questions | Weightage (%) | Key Topics |
| Analysis of Business Situations | 20 | 20% | Case analysis, decision-making, data interpretation. |
| Reading Comprehension | 20 | 20% | Passages on business, literature, and social issues. |
| Quantitative Aptitude | 20 | 20% | Arithmetic, Algebra, Geometry, Number Systems. |
| Data Sufficiency | 20 | 20% | Tables, graphs, logical evaluation of data. |
| English Usage | 20 | 20% | Grammar, vocabulary, sentence correction. |
